Is there an expression to describe somebody completely unknown, the greatest nobody among all other nobodies? Thank you
  

Top answer

Denisa 0610 Is there an expression to describe somebody completely unknown, the greatest nobody among all other nobodies? Thank you "the greatest nobody" doesn't fit very well with what you are asking about, because it can make one think of someone who is very very accomplshed but almost unknown. The 'biggest nobody' sounds better to me.
